What is Forestry Connect?
It is the professional home of the UK forestry industry: a members-only feed, an industry directory, private messaging, and a jobs and contracts board, all in one place built around how forestry actually works.
How much does membership cost?
Individual membership is £6.99 a month, or £75.49 a year (which saves you 10%). Companies pay £24.99 a month, which includes 3 seats, and can add a seat block as the team grows. Annual billing saves companies 10% too. See the pricing page for the current figures.
What do I get as an individual member?
The full community: post to the feed, build your own profile page, appear in the member directory (only if you want to), connect with other members, send private messages, browse every job in full and save job alerts so new matches land in your inbox.
What does a company membership add?
Everything an individual has, for each seat, plus the ability to post jobs and contracts, a company page with your own branding, and team management so your company admin decides who holds a seat and what each seat can do.
How do company seats work?
Your membership includes 3 seats, one of which is the company admin. Need more? Seats are sold in blocks (up to 10, 11 to 25, 26 to 50, and 51 plus), so you pay for the size of team you actually have. You can change block as you grow.
What is a Collaborator?
Collaborators are hand-picked partner organisations and individuals invited by the Forestry Connect team. They carry a Collaborator badge on the feed and have their own tab in the directory. Collaborator access is by invitation only.
Can I cancel anytime?
Yes. Manage or cancel from your account in a couple of clicks. Your membership runs to the end of the period you have paid for and simply does not renew. The full detail is in our cancellation terms.
Can I switch between monthly and annual?
Yes, from the billing area of your account. The change takes effect at your next renewal.
Do you take payments from outside the UK?
Yes. Prices are in pounds sterling and our payment provider, Stripe, accepts international cards; your bank converts at its usual rate.
Is my card safe?
Payments are handled end to end by Stripe, one of the world’s largest payment providers. We never see or store your card details.
Who can see my profile?
You decide. New profiles are hidden from the directory until you choose to list them, and you control which contact details are shown. Visitors who are not members only ever see a limited teaser of the directory.
How is my account kept secure?
Every login needs your password plus a one-time code sent to your email, so a stolen password on its own is not enough to get in.
How do jobs and job alerts work?
Everyone can see job titles and locations. Members see the full details and how to apply, and can save a search as an alert so new matching listings are emailed to them. Company members can post jobs and contracts.
What happens if my payment fails?
Stripe retries the payment and emails you to update your card. If payment cannot be collected after the retries, access is paused until it is sorted, then everything comes straight back.
